Description
I developed a brief dietary questionnaire, the Bristol Diabetes and Diet Questionnaire, for clinical use with people with Type 2 diabetes. This questionnaire rapidly identifies dietary habits, focussing on foods and dietary practices that are of importance in the management of Type 2 diabetes or impaired glucose tolerance. The questionnaire can be scored quickly by someone with basic knowledge of nutrition. It is designed to be used to set specific dietary goals which aid in weight reduction, glucose control or help lower risk factors associated with heart disease. The questionnaire is reliable but needs further work, with pre-existing data, to demonstrate that it is accurate enough to be used in clinical practice. I will also ask two GP practices from the greater Bristol area to conduct a feasibility study of the questionnaire. Feedback from this study will help design a definitive study to answer whether this questionnaire can help patients to lose weight, improve glucose control and lower risk factor for heart disease.
